Subject: [PATCH] Fix rpath in libtool when sysroot is enabled
Enabling sysroot support in libtool exposed a bug where the final
library had an RPATH encoded into it which still pointed to the
sysroot. This works around the issue until it gets sorted out
upstream.
Fix suggested by Richard Purdie <richard.purdie@linuxfoundation.org>
Upstream-Status: Inappropriate [embedded specific]
